Output f43421e7e3e5a1d8e4d1dfd23fb97c7ccf2ed1cedca4ecec476ef63ffae47a49:0

value
30554431
script pubkey
OP_0 OP_PUSHBYTES_20 95df61f3dad4de9cf65cb3484451d7b56f2a5dba
address
bc1qjh0kru766n0feajukdyyg5whk4hj5hd6xmug0l
transaction
f43421e7e3e5a1d8e4d1dfd23fb97c7ccf2ed1cedca4ecec476ef63ffae47a49
confirmations
1353
spent
true